This is the home of the Berkshire and South Buckinghamshire Bat Group. We are an informal but growing group working to conserve bats and their habitats in Berkshire and surrounding areas. Berks Business Community Network. Berks Business Community Network (BCN) is a group of men who are followers of Jesus Christ and leaders within the marketplace. Our goal is to meet together to discern how best we can better follow Christ and serve our families, communities, and county. We base our discussion on the Word and the wisdom of our pooled experience as Christian men running or leading businesses in Berks county.
